Being involved in a car wreck can be a stressful and overwhelming experience. In the moments following an accident, it can be difficult to think clearly and know what to do next. However, taking the right steps after a collision can help protect your safety and make the insurance and repair process smoother. Here are five important steps to take after you’ve been involved in a collision. Check for Injuries/Take Safety Precautions Your first priority should always be safety. Check yourself and any passengers for injuries, and call emergency services if anyone needs medical attention. If the vehicles are drivable and it’s safe to do so, move them out of traffic to prevent further accidents. Turn on hazard lights to alert other drivers and stay in a safe location while waiting for help. Contact Law Enforcement Calling the police is an important step, even in minor accidents. An officer can document the scene, gather statements, and create an official accident report. This report can be valuable when filing an insurance claim or resolving disputes about fault. Exchange Information with the Other Driver It’s best to collect essential information from the other driver, including their name, contact details, driver’s license number, license plate, and insurance information. You should also provide your own details. Avoid discussing fault with them at the scene. Simply focus on exchanging accurate information. Document the Scene Thoroughly If you don’t need immediate medical attention, use your phone to take photos and videos of the accident scene, including vehicle damage, road conditions, and traffic signs. If there are witnesses, ask for their contact information as well. Detailed documentation can support your claim and help establish what happened during the accident. Contact Your Insurance Company and Choose a Reputable Repair Shop Notify your insurance company as soon as possible to begin the claims process. Provide them with all the information and documentation you’ve gathered. They can guide you through the next steps. Choosing a reputable collision repair shop helps ensure your vehicle is restored safely and correctly. Being involved in a vehicle accident can be overwhelming, and the repair process often raises many questions for drivers. Collision repair focuses on restoring a vehicle after it has been damaged in an accident, whether the damage is cosmetic or structural. Modern vehicles are built with advanced materials and technology, making professional repair essential to ensure safety and proper performance. Having a better sense of how collision repair works can help you feel more confident about the process and what to expect. Collision repair addresses a wide range of vehicle damage caused by accidents. This can include repairing dents, replacing damaged body panels, restoring scratched or chipped paint, and repairing bumpers or fenders. In more serious collisions, technicians may also repair structural components such as the vehicle’s frame or unibody structure. How Is Collision Damage Diagnosed? Before repairs begin, technicians perform a detailed inspection of the vehicle to identify both visible and hidden damage. This process may include measuring the frame for alignment issues and examining internal components. Even minor-looking accidents can sometimes cause underlying problems, so a thorough assessment helps ensure nothing is overlooked during the repair process. Will the Paint Match After the Repair? One common concern drivers have is whether their vehicle’s paint will match after repairs are completed. Professional collision repair shops use advanced color-matching technology to replicate the exact shade and finish of your vehicle’s original paint. Technicians carefully blend the new paint with the surrounding panels to create a seamless appearance. When done properly, the repaired area should match the rest of the vehicle. Do I Get to Choose My Repair Shop? Many drivers believe they must use the repair shop recommended by their insurance company, but you have the right to choose where your vehicle is repaired. While insurance providers may suggest certain shops, the final decision typically belongs to the vehicle owner. Where Can I Get Collision Repair in Chamblee, GA? Small dents and dings are a common frustration for vehicle owners. Paintless dent repair, often called PDR, has become a popular solution for fixing minor damage without the need for traditional bodywork or repainting. Understanding how this process works can help you decide if it’s the right choice for your vehicle. Paintless dent repair is a specialized technique used to remove minor dents without sanding, filling, or repainting the damaged area. Skilled technicians use precise tools to gently massage the metal back into its original shape from behind the panel. Because the factory paint remains intact, the repair blends seamlessly with the rest of the vehicle. This method preserves the original finish. What Types of Damage Can PDR Fix? PDR works best on small to medium-sized dents where the paint surface has not been cracked or chipped. Common examples include door dings and hail damage. Advances in modern automotive paint allow many dents to be repaired successfully. However, extensive body damage or areas where the paint has been broken may require traditional repair methods instead. How Long Does Paintless Dent Repair Take? One of the biggest advantages of paintless dent repair is how quickly it can be completed. Many minor dents can be fixed in just a few hours. More extensive hail damage or numerous dents may take longer. Because there is no need for paint drying or curing time, PDR is typically much faster than conventional repairs. Is Paintless Dent Repair More Affordable? In many cases, PDR costs less than traditional dent repair. Since there is no need for body filler, sanding, or repainting, labor and material costs are lower. Where Can I Get Paintless Dent Repair in Chamblee, GA? A custom paint job is one of the most impactful ways to transform the look of your vehicle. Whether you’re restoring a classic car or personalizing a daily driver, custom paint offers more than just visual appeal. Here are four great reasons to invest in a custom paint job for your vehicle. Unique Style and Personal Expression One of the biggest reasons to choose a custom paint job is the opportunity to create a look that reflects your personality. Unlike factory colors, custom finishes allow for unique hues, special effects, or personalized details that set your vehicle apart. From subtle metallic tones to bold, eye-catching designs, custom paint ensures your vehicle stands out while showcasing your individual style. Improved Exterior Protection A high-quality custom paint job does more than improve appearance—it adds a protective layer to your vehicle’s body. Professional preparation and application help seal the surface against moisture and environmental contaminants. This protection can reduce the risk of rust and surface deterioration, helping preserve the vehicle’s exterior for years to come. Restoration of Aging or Damaged Paint Over time, factory paint can fade, peel, or become damaged from sun exposure and road wear. A custom paint job can restore a vehicle’s finish to like-new condition. This is especially valuable for older vehicles or classic cars where original paint has deteriorated. A fresh, professionally applied finish can dramatically improve the car’s overall appearance. Increased Pride of Ownership Driving a vehicle with a custom paint job often brings a renewed sense of pride and enjoyment. A polished, distinctive finish makes your car feel special and well cared for. This emotional benefit shouldn’t be underestimated, as it can enhance your overall driving experience and motivate you to maintain the rest of the vehicle to the same high standard. Keeping your car’s paint job in good condition is important for maintaining its appearance, resale value, and long-term protection against the elements. Unfortunately, scratches are one of the most common forms of cosmetic damage vehicles experience. Understanding what causes scratches can help you take simple steps to prevent them. However, if your car does get scratched, you’ll want to get the repairs done promptly so rust doesn’t get the chance to take hold. Improper Washing Techniques One of the biggest sources of scratches comes from washing the vehicle with the wrong tools or methods. Old sponges, dirty rags, and abrasive brushes can trap dirt and grit that drag across the paint’s surface, leaving fine scratches and swirl marks.Even wiping dust or pollen off the car with a dry cloth can cause micro-scratching. Using proper washing materials, such as microfiber mitts and the two-bucket method, is essential for protecting your vehicle’s paint. Parking Lot Incidents Parking lots are a major danger zone for paint damage. Tight spaces, careless drivers, and crowded conditions all contribute to scratches and dings. Car doors from neighboring vehicles can swing open and strike your car. Shopping carts may roll into the body panels. Even pedestrians brushing by with bags or backpacks can leave marks. While it’s impossible to avoid all risks, parking farther away, choosing end spots, and avoiding congested areas can help reduce the likelihood of parking lot mishaps. Road Debris Small rocks and other debris kicked up by passing vehicles can strike your paint at high speed, causing chips and scratches. Rough roads or construction zones increase this risk. Maintaining a safe following distance can help mitigate this risk. Also, a good wax provides an additional barrier between your paint and abrasive elements. Accidental Contact with Objects Everyday situations can lead to unexpected scratches. Leaning against the car while wearing clothing with zippers or metal buttons, placing bags or tools on the hood, and brushing the car with ladders, lawn equipment, or bikes can all cause noticeable marks. Even pets jumping against the vehicle can leave scratches. Being mindful of what comes into contact with your car helps prevent unnecessary damage. A well-maintained paint job not only makes your car look stylish, but also helps protect the exterior from corrosion and weather damage. Over time, sunlight, road debris, and harsh weather can take a toll on your vehicle’s finish. Fortunately, with a little consistent care and attention, you can keep your car’s paint looking fresh for many years. Here are four tips for preserving that showroom shine long-term. Wash Regularly with Proper Technique One of the easiest and most effective ways to protect your car’s paint is through regular washing. Dirt, bird droppings, and other contaminants can wear down the paint if left for too long. Use a gentle automotive soap, a soft microfiber mitt, and rinse thoroughly to avoid scratches. Make sure to dry your car completely with a clean towel to prevent water spots. Apply Wax for Extra Protection Waxing your car adds a crucial layer of protection that helps shield the paint from UV rays, rain, and contaminants. Generally, it’s a good idea to apply high-quality wax every three to four months. A quality wax enhances the shine while making it easier to wash off grime later. This protective step is a simple investment that keeps the paint looking vibrant. Promptly Address Chips and Scratches Even minor paint damage can allow moisture to reach the underlying metal, leading to rust. That’s why it’s important to touch up small chips or scratches right away. Professionals can quickly repair these blemishes to prevent long-term damage. Keeping up with small fixes helps ensure your paint stays smooth. Park in Covered Areas Direct sunlight is one of the biggest enemies of car paint. Prolonged UV exposure can cause fading, oxidation, and cracking. Whenever possible, park your vehicle in a garage, carport, or shaded area. If you must park outside frequently, consider using a high-quality car cover to reduce the effects of the sun and other environmental elements.
